2010 Net Impact Conference
Best of the 2010 Net Impact Conference
Hosted by: University of Michigan, Ross School of Business
What will the year 2020 look like? As we enter a new decade, can we create a shared vision of sustainability going forward? More than 2,500 attendees tackled these tough questions over three packed days at our 18th annual conference. Speakers and attendees alike shared their ideas and experiences — and left with the know-how to make their vision a reality.
October 28-30, 2010 | Ann Arbor, MI
